盲人软件,通常被称为屏幕阅读器或辅助技术软件,是一类专门设计用于协助视觉障碍用户操作电子设备的计算机程序。这类软件的核心功能在于,通过非视觉的交互方式,将数字界面上的文字、图像和控制元素转化为可感知的听觉或触觉信息,从而帮助用户独立地浏览网页、处理文档、管理文件以及进行通讯交流。
核心功能分类 其核心功能主要围绕信息转换与导航交互展开。在信息转换层面,软件能够实时识别并朗读屏幕上的文本内容,无论是网页文章、办公文档还是系统菜单。同时,对于复杂的图形元素,软件会尝试提供简洁的描述。在导航交互层面,软件允许用户通过一系列键盘快捷键或手势命令,精准地定位光标、切换焦点、选择项目并执行操作,模拟出类似鼠标点击的效果,形成了一套高效的非视觉操作逻辑。 技术实现分类 从技术实现角度看,这类软件可大致分为系统内置与独立应用两类。许多主流操作系统,例如视窗和苹果系统,均已集成基础性的屏幕朗读功能。而功能更为强大的独立应用软件,则提供了更深度的定制选项、对更多专业软件的兼容支持以及更自然的语音合成效果,以满足不同用户的个性化需求。 应用领域分类 在应用领域上,盲人软件已渗透到学习、工作与生活的多个场景。在教育领域,它帮助学生阅读电子教材、完成在线作业;在职业场合,它助力从业者处理电子邮件、编辑报表、进行程序编码;在日常生活中,它更是用户畅游网络、参与社交、享受影音娱乐不可或缺的工具。这些软件的发展,不仅体现了技术的温度,更是推动信息平等、促进社会包容的重要力量,为视障群体打开了通往数字世界的大门。在数字化浪潮席卷全球的今天,信息获取与处理能力已成为个体参与社会生活的关键。对于视障群体而言,盲人软件——这一系列精妙的辅助技术工具,扮演着桥梁与钥匙的角色,弥合了感官限制与数字鸿沟之间的缝隙。它并非单一的程序,而是一个涵盖多种技术路径、适配不同场景需求的生态系统,其设计与演进深刻反映了人机交互技术的进步与社会人文关怀的深化。
技术原理与核心工作机制剖析 盲人软件工作的基石,在于与操作系统及应用程序的深度交互。它通过应用程序接口持续监控系统消息队列,实时捕捉屏幕上任何可视元素的创建、更新、焦点变化等事件。对于文本内容,软件直接获取其底层字符编码;对于图形界面控件,如按钮、列表框,则获取其预设的名称、角色、状态等可访问属性信息。获取原始信息后,软件的核心引擎对其进行解析、组织与排序,形成一条线性的、符合逻辑的非视觉信息流。 随后,信息输出模块开始工作。语音合成器将文本流转换为自然流畅的语音,其质量取决于合成引擎的智能程度,包括对多音字、语速、语调、停顿乃至情感色彩的处理。对于需要精确定位或图形感知的用户,软件会驱动可刷新盲文显示器,将字符动态转化为凸起的盲文点字,提供触觉反馈。导航控制模块则定义了一套完备的键盘命令体系,用户通过记忆和组合这些命令,可以像熟练的钢琴家弹奏乐曲一样,高效地浏览网页结构、在文档中跳转、操作表格数据,实现与复杂界面的无缝互动。 主要软件类型及其代表性产品 市场上的盲人软件可根据其集成度、功能侧重与适用平台进行细分。首先是集成于操作系统内部的解决方案,例如微软系统自带的讲述人功能,以及苹果设备上深度整合的旁白功能。它们开箱即用,提供了基础而可靠的访问能力,是许多用户接触数字世界的起点。 其次是功能强大的专业独立屏幕阅读软件。这类产品在视障群体中享有极高声誉,它们支持几乎所有的桌面应用程序,拥有高度可定制的语音方案、详尽的浏览模式以及对各种编程环境的出色支持,是视障专业人士从事软件开发、数据分析等工作的得力助手。另一款广受欢迎的开源屏幕阅读器,则以其免费、开源、社区驱动和跨平台支持的特性,赢得了全球大量用户的青睐。 再者是专注于移动智能设备的屏幕阅读应用。随着智能手机的普及,针对安卓与苹果移动操作系统的屏幕阅读工具变得至关重要。它们利用触摸屏特性,开发出了独特的手势操作逻辑,用户通过在屏幕上滑动、轻点、旋转等手势,即可接听电话、发送信息、使用各类手机应用,极大地拓展了移动生活的可能性。 关键应用场景与社会价值体现 盲人软件的价值在具体应用场景中得到充分彰显。在教育领域,它打破了传统盲文教材的局限,使学生能够即时访问海量的网络学术资源、电子图书馆和在线课程平台,实现了无障碍学习。在职业教育与就业方面,它赋能视障人士从事客服、咨询、法律、信息技术等多种职业,通过操作办公软件、客户关系管理系统乃至集成开发环境,他们得以在职场中展现同等价值,促进就业平等与经济独立。 在日常生活与社会参与层面,这类软件的作用更是无处不在。它让用户能够自主进行网上购物、办理银行业务、预约出行服务,提升了生活自理能力与便利性。在社交娱乐方面,用户可以通过软件操作社交媒体、收听网络广播、欣赏有声读物,甚至在一定程度上体验经过描述的影视内容,丰富了精神文化生活。更重要的是,它成为了视障群体获取公共信息、表达意见、参与社区事务的重要渠道,增强了他们的社会归属感与公民参与度。 发展面临的挑战与未来趋势展望 尽管成就显著,盲人软件的发展仍面临挑战。软件与网页的可访问性标准遵循程度不一,许多新兴的复杂网页应用和富媒体内容仍存在访问障碍。软件的购置与更新成本,以及学习使用所需的时间精力,对部分用户而言仍是门槛。此外,如何更好地处理非结构化信息、复杂图表和动态交互内容,是技术上的持续难题。 展望未来,盲人软件正朝着更智能、更融合、更普惠的方向演进。人工智能与机器学习的融入,将提升软件对图像内容自动生成准确描述的能力,并实现更智能的上下文导航。与物联网设备的结合,将使软件能够帮助用户操控智能家居,进一步扩展无障碍生活场景。云服务模式可能降低使用成本,并通过在线配置同步满足个性化需求。同时,推动全球范围内更严格的数字产品可访问性立法与标准实施,将从源头改善软件与内容的兼容性。盲人软件的每一次进化,都不只是技术的迭代,更是向着构建一个真正无障碍、包容性数字社会的坚实迈进,确保每个人都能平等地享受技术革命带来的红利。
133人看过